Pro Yakyuu World Stadium
Pro Yakyuu World Stadium is the first baseball game released for the PC-Engine. The general gameplay as well as the graphics style closely resembles that of Namco's own "Family Stadium/Famista" baseball series for the Nintendo NES/Famicom. Game options include a one or two-player mode as well as watching two computer opponents play against each other. Players can choose from one of ten non-licensed teams. The game itself follows the standard formula of nearly all baseball games of its time, with having a 3rd-person view from behind the batter during the pitching/batting scenes and an overhead view of the field once the player hits the ball. Progress is saved via passwords given after each match.
